Original Recipe Yield 24 servings
 

Ingredients

  • 1 2/3 cups warm water (70 to 80 degrees F)
  • 2 tablespoons nonfat dry milk powder
  • 2 tablespoons sugar
  • 2 tablespoons shortening
  • 1 1/4 teaspoons salt
  • 4 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 2 1/4 teaspoons active dry yeast
  • 1/2 cup chopped onion
  • 1/2 cup sliced fresh mushrooms
  • 1/2 cup chopped green pepper
  • 1/2 cup chopped sweet red pepper
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1/3 cup pizza sauce
  • 1/2 cup diced pepperoni
  • 1 cup shredded pizza cheese blend
  • 1/4 cup chopped ripe olives
  • 2 tablespoons grated Parmesan cheese

Directions

  1. In bread machine pan, place the first seven ingredients in order suggested by manufacturer. Select dough setting (check dough after 5 minutes of mixing; add 1 to 2 tablespoons of water or flour if needed).
  2. In a small skillet, saute the onion, mushrooms and peppers in oil until tender; cool. When bread machine cycle is completed, turn dough onto a lightly floured surface; divide in half. Let rest for 5 minutes.
  3. Roll each portion into a 16-in. x 10-in. rectangle; spread with pizza sauce. Top with onion mixture, pepperoni, pizza cheese and olives. Roll up each rectangle jelly-roll style, starting with a long side; pinch seam to seal. Cut each into 12 slices (discard end pieces).
  4. Place slices cut side down in two greased 9-in. round baking pans. Sprinkle with Parmesan cheese. Cover and let rise until doubled, about 30 minutes. Bake at 375 degrees F for 18-22 minutes or until golden brown. Serve warm.
